Revenue Operations Coordinator

Fintel ConnectVancouver, BC
$65,000 - $65,000Hybrid

About The Position

The Revenue Operations Coordinator is a role designed for someone eager to learn how revenue teams operate and how the business and industry work end‑to-end. This role supports the Sales and Marketing teams by helping coordinate day‑to-day operations, maintain key processes, and ensure initiatives move forward smoothly. The role offers hands‑on exposure to revenue strategy, sales and operations in a dynamic environment. The ideal candidate is organized, curious, and proactive, with a strong interest in learning the business, developing operational skills, and growing their career.

Requirements

  • Bachelor's degree in business, marketing or related; 3+ years of related work experience
  • Strong organizational skills with the ability to juggle multiple tasks and shifting priorities
  • Clear and confident communicator, both written and verbal
  • Self‑starter mindset — someone who takes initiative and doesn’t wait to be told what to do
  • Comfortable working in a fast‑paced, dynamic environment where priorities can evolve
  • Curious and eager to learn, and open to feedback
  • Detail‑oriented, with a high level of accuracy and follow‑through
  • Team‑oriented attitude with a willingness to jump in and help where needed

Responsibilities

  • Assist in the development and execution of comprehensive sales and marketing plans, supporting broader revenue and growth objectives
  • Support day‑to-day revenue operations activities, including reporting, data updates, process coordination, and maintaining internal trackers, dashboards, and documentation
  • Provide administrative and operational support to Business Development and Revenue team members, including calendar management, meeting coordination, scheduling, and occasional travel support
  • Support sales and revenue meetings by preparing agendas, capturing meeting notes, and following up on action items to ensure accountability and progress
  • Assist in the organization of sales events, trade shows, and promotional activities to generate leads and increase brand visibility.
  • Conduct research on sales opportunities, market trends, and competitive insights to help identify potential areas for growth
  • Serve as a central point of contact for internal and external stakeholders, responding to requests and inquiries in a clear, timely, and professional manner
  • Coordinate across cross-functional teams to ensure deliverables stay on track and timelines are met
  • Identify gaps or inefficiencies in processes and proactively suggest improvements
  • Take ownership of assigned tasks and follow through with minimal supervision, demonstrating initiative and accountability
  • Handle sensitive information with discretion, always maintaining confidentiality and integrity
